rudoji klifinė kregždė statusas T sritis zoologija | vardynas atitikmenys: lot. Petrochelidon fulva angl. cave swallow vok. Höhlenschwalbe, f rus. пещерная горная ласточка, f pranc. hirondelle à front brun, f ryšiai: platesnis terminasklifinės kregždės
